Since I started working on patch 1 when debugging the race anyway, I cleaned it up so we can use the same memfd for both hugetlb and shmem which is cleaner.
Then I figured it's not hard if with patch 1 to replace all the file-based test to use memfd for hugetlbb so I did. Then patch 4 dropped the hugetlb mntpoint for run_vmtests.sh.
Please have a look, thanks.
Peter Xu (4): selftests/vm: Use memfd for hugetlb tests selftests/vm: Use memfd for hugetlb-madvise test selftests/vm: Use memfd for hugepage-mremap test selftests/vm: Drop mnt point for hugetlb in run_vmtests.sh
